The History and Significance of International Podcast Day
International Podcast Day highlights the journey of podcasting from its early days to its current prominence. Understanding the history and significance of International Podcast Day provides context for the celebration and its continued relevance. The day serves as an annual opportunity to reflect on the growth of podcasting and its impact on media and culture. Let's delve into how this day came to be and why it matters.
The origins of International Podcast Day trace back to 2014, thanks to podcast enthusiast Steve Lee. Lee envisioned a day dedicated to connecting podcasters and listeners worldwide, fostering a sense of community and collaboration. The inaugural celebration took place on September 30, 2014, and it has been observed annually on the same date ever since. This day is not just a date on the calendar; it's a symbolic recognition of the efforts of content creators and the loyalty of podcast listeners. The creation of this day underscores the importance of podcasting as a vital communication medium.

One of the key trends shaping the future of podcasting is the increasing integration of video. Video podcasts are gaining popularity, offering a more immersive and engaging experience for listeners. This trend is likely to continue, with more podcasters experimenting with video formats to enhance their content. Platforms are also adapting to accommodate video podcasts, making them more accessible to audiences. This shift towards video reflects the broader convergence of audio and visual media, creating new opportunities for content creators.
Another significant trend is the growing emphasis on niche content. While mainstream podcasts continue to thrive, there's a rising demand for specialized content that caters to specific interests and communities. This trend is driving the diversification of podcasting, with creators focusing on niche topics to attract loyal audiences. International Podcast Day provides a platform for these niche podcasts to gain visibility and connect with their target audience. The increased focus on targeted content demonstrates a maturing market, where audience preferences are becoming more refined.

When is International Podcast Day celebrated?
International Podcast Day is celebrated annually on September 30th. This date was chosen to commemorate the inaugural celebration in 2014, and it has since become a consistent date for podcast enthusiasts around the globe to come together and celebrate. The fixed date helps to create a predictable and consistent event for the podcasting community to anticipate each year.
